
Business Hotels in Machu Picchu 2025
Featured Machu Picchu Business Hotels

Casa Andina Standard Machu Picchu
Prolongacion Imperio de los Incas 626, Machu Picchu, Cusco

Eco Machu Picchu Pueblo
Calle Aymuraypa Tikan 112, Machu Picchu, Cusco

Hostal La Payacha
Av. Imperio de los Incas #39, Machu Picchu, Cusco
Fully refundableReserve now, pay when you stay
Save an average of 15% on thousands of hotels when you're signed in

Hotel Waman
Calle Wiracocha Nº 202, Machu Picchu, Cusco

Inti Punku MachuPicchu Hotel & Suites
Calle Kori Wakanki 209, Urbanización Las Orquídeas, Machu Picchu

Intillaqta MachuPicchu Pueblo
Urb. Las Orquideas Av. Los Artesanos, Machu Picchu, Cusco

Marco Wasi
Pasaje Selva Alegre 103, Machu Picchu, Cusco

Sumaq Machu Picchu Hotel
Av. Hermanos Ayar Mz 1 Lote 3, Machu Picchu, Cusco

Tierra Viva Machu Picchu
Av. Hermanos Ayar 401, Machu Picchu, Cusco
Fully refundableReserve now, pay when you stay
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.